Taxonomic Classification

Rank Cape Spiny Mouse Decurrent Mullein
Kingdom Animalia (Animals) Plantae (Plants)
Phylum Chordata (Chordates) Magnoliophyta (Flowering Plants)
Class Mammalia (Mammals) Magnoliopsida (Dicots)
Order Rodentia (Rodents) Lamiales (Lamiales)
Family Muridae (Mice & Rats) Scrophulariaceae
Genus Acomys Verbascum
Species Acomys subspinosus Verbascum decursivum
